21 Year Old Drunk Driver Hits Snowplow On Hwy 21 – Name Released

(HURON TWP, ON) – On March 11, 2017 at 9:50 a.m., the South Bruce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) received a report of a crash involving a snow plow at the intersection of Highway 21 and Bruce County Road 6 in Huron Township. Officers arrived to find that a Silver Honda Civic had collided with a Yellow Western snow plow. The driver of the Civic was found to have been drinking alcohol. Twenty-one-year old Taylor NEEB of Huron-Kinloss Township was charged with operate over 80 milligrams, disobey stop sign and window obstructed. She is scheduled to appear in court on April 5, 2017 to answer to the charges. There were no injuries reported at the scene.
